Family Background of Erika Mushorn Obituary
Erika Mushorn’s family was the center of her world and the foundation of her unwavering dedication and love. Born into a close-knit family, Erika was the cherished daughter of Wendy L. Mushorn and the late Wade C. Mushorn. Her upbringing in Halfmoon, New York, was filled with warmth and togetherness, shaping her into a compassionate and resilient individual. Erika shared a deep bond with her sister, April, and they supported each other in both personal and professional pursuits, exemplifying the strength of sibling love.
Erika’s role as a mother was one she embraced wholeheartedly, and it became her life’s greatest joy. She was a devoted and loving mother to five beautiful children: Derek A. Matala Jr., Nathan J. Matala, Dominick A. Matala, Nina E. Matala, and Grace L. Matala. Each of her children held a unique and irreplaceable place in her heart, and Erika worked tirelessly to ensure they grew up surrounded by love, care, and encouragement. Whether it was celebrating their achievements, comforting them during challenges, or simply sharing everyday moments, Erika’s dedication to her children was evident in everything she did.
Her partner, Derek Matala, was her unwavering support and companion in life. Together, they created a home filled with laughter, love, and resilience in Lansingburg, New York. Erika and Derek shared a bond built on mutual respect and shared values, and their love served as the cornerstone of their family. They navigated life’s ups and downs side by side, finding strength in each other and in their shared commitment to their children.
Erika’s extended family also played a significant role in her life. She held a deep respect for the memories of her late father, Wade, and her grandmother, Joan Mushorn, as well as her uncle, Scott Mushorn. These family members remained close to her heart and served as a source of inspiration and strength throughout her life.

Professional Life and Achievements
Erika Mushorn Obituary work ethic and passion for helping others were evident in her professional journey. She began her career as a customer service manager at the Halfmoon Walmart, where she was known for her exceptional ability to connect with both customers and colleagues. Erika’s natural empathy and communication skills made her a respected leader within the organization.
Most lately, Erika worked alongside her family, April, at Hewitt’s Garden Center in Halfmoon. This role allowed her to combine her love for nature with her dedication to family. Working in an environment surrounded by greenery and growth, Erika found joy in helping others beautify their spaces while fostering her own creativity.
